Diogo Bernardo Monteiro joined Eversheds Sutherland in 2000 and became a Partner in 2009. He coordinates the Tax Department.
He develops most of his activity in tax consultancy and litigation and international and domestic tax planning, in the Portuguese, Angolan and Mozambican jurisdictions. He is an experienced tax lawyer very active in providing tax advice to the clients at every stage of transactions, on all aspects of domestic and international tax, in co-ordination with the other practice areas, providing tax-related advice as part of an integrated service, as well as direct advice to the clients. This has led to his recognition and recommendation in several international legal directories.
In 2014, he was appointed to the Corporate Income Tax Reform Monitoring Committee by the Secretary of State for Tax Affairs.
More recently, Diogo was appointed as chairman of the Tax and Social Security Counsel of CIP – Confederation of Portuguese Business.
